Kevin Fenzi
Greetings. I work for Red Hat as the Fedora Infrastructure Lead. This means I work on keeping all the servers that run Fedora running.
I also do lots of other things for Fedora in my "spare" time.
Things I do/work on in Fedora:
- I've been on FESCo since it has existed.
- I am a SCMAdmin, and process SCM requests for new packages or branches sometimes.
- I'm a packaging Sponsor and help review and sponsor new packagers.
- I (co)maintain the Xfce packages in Fedora, as well as many others.
- I Help run the IRC Support SIG group to try and improve support on #fedora on freenode.
- I Help out as time permits in #fedora on freenode.
- I run the fedbot that is used in #fedora
- I Help maintain the Xfce spin and am active in the SPINS sig.
- I am in EPEL-releng and help process requests there as well as help run EPEL meetings.
- I create the nightly live image composes for testing found here
- I am in the sysadmin-tools group and help manage and create new mailing lists.
